Transaction 75d6053c50fa5945aaeb80c27624f835b0bd1d3cc03a27091aa832deb49ac77a

1 Input
2 Outputs
  • 75d6053c50fa5945aaeb80c27624f835b0bd1d3cc03a27091aa832deb49ac77a:0
  • value  100000
    address  14k2eKH3HcnM1DKWS7TfRxmbDsaW4SZvDZ
  • 75d6053c50fa5945aaeb80c27624f835b0bd1d3cc03a27091aa832deb49ac77a:1
  • value  436583
    address  1CQK7JjdEGQawCNq35VK35sDzrtDQogmdC